Fernando Ronquillo Sr.
October 21st, 1943 - February 13th, 2023
79 years old, born in Ciudad Juarez, Chihuahua raised in El Paso, Texas. He is survived by his wife of 51 years, Maria Dolores. His daughters Cynthia Ronquillo (Daughter-in-law CC Salazar), Olga Mendez, and Rosario Garcia; Sons Fernando Ronquillo II (Daughter-in-law Sonia Rios) and Manuel Sifuentes (Daughter-in-Law Margarita Sifuentes); Grandsons Fernando Ronquillo III, Dominick Salerno-Ronquillo, Alex Sifuentes and Victor Sifuentes and numerous more grandchildren and great-grandchildren whom he indeared as his own, numerous nieces, nephews, and Brothers Roberto Ronquillo, Carlos Ronquillo, Luis Ronquillo, Paulo Contreras, Maike Contreras, and Gilberto Ronquillo.
